This is a heavy, geometric sans built from rounded-rectangle and superellipse forms, with smooth corners and largely uniform stroke behavior. Counters are squarish and open, and many joins resolve into clean radii rather than sharp terminals, producing a cohesive, modular rhythm. Proportions lean broad and stable, with compact apertures and a strong horizontal emphasis that makes lines look dense and solid. The lowercase shows single-storey constructions (notably a and g), reinforcing the contemporary, simplified silhouette.
It fits best in branding, headlines, posters, and product/UI titling where a modern, tech-leaning personality is desired. The sturdy shapes and rounded geometry also suit signage, wayfinding, esports or automotive-inspired graphics, and packaging that needs a strong, compact word image. For long-form text, it is likely most effective in short blocks, callouts, or navigational labels rather than continuous reading.

The overall texture is very even and blocky, with rounded terminals and rectangular inner spaces that create a consistent, modular pattern across lines. Numerals follow the same rounded-rect logic, staying visually aligned with the letterforms for cohesive display typography.
